Description Katie Weigel with Robert Half Finance and Accounting is recruiting to fill a Controller role for an international mining company that has recently acquired an operating mine in Nevada. The person in this role will be a one person show for approximately the first year, and then is expected to grow their staff to 3-4 people. Initially the person will be responsible for:
Monthly quarterly and annual management accounts
Managing the external audit process
Managing day to day banking issues and payments including processing payroll
Assisting with filing of tax returns
General admin duties such as KYC forms for suppliers or onboarding forms for banks and or other creditors as well as forms for onboarding service providers or counterparties such as refineries etc.
The job is located in Reno with periodic travel to the mine site, approximately 220 miles from Reno. As the company is being newly formed, benefits are not yet in place but there will be a competitive benefits package and bonus. This is a start up venture with an established operating company, so the risk is less than in some start up cases but the need to establish technology, processes, etc. for a first time operation in the US is definitely a requirement of the role.
